Transaction 40fcb23a2632f39f434fee5ede20cadcf8e3f3fce022f5b95646f64fa4e72006

2 Input
2 Outputs
  • 40fcb23a2632f39f434fee5ede20cadcf8e3f3fce022f5b95646f64fa4e72006:0
  • value  6825059
    address  3BksUaJhKoUun6m5Y5ffcyeHWmtyn2eqt2
  • 40fcb23a2632f39f434fee5ede20cadcf8e3f3fce022f5b95646f64fa4e72006:1
  • value  33575640
    address  1KPZ9NzZyPkvTTQrhXT1oAVAyVtDqTE24a